Position Summary of the Respiratory Therapist RT: The primary purpose of this position is to provide direct Respiratory care to the residents to restore pulmonary function; alleviate pain; support life by planning and administering medically prescribed respiratory therapy. This is not a traveling position, the setting is in a skilled and long term nursing care facility. Qualifications of the Respiratory Therapist RT: This position requires a current valid Licensed Respiratory Therapist issued in the state where the person will practice. Must have thorough knowledge of respiratory techniques, and practices. Must have a thorough knowledge of the specialized procedures applied, and equipment used, in the assigned unit. Must be able to demonstrate leadership and organizational skills, and provide positive attitude, and direction for the nursing staff. Up-to-date physical assessment skills and comprehensive knowledge of respiratory principles are required. Must be CPR certified. Recent experience in geriatric or rehabilitative nursing and experience preferred. Essential Functions of the Respiratory Therapist RT: Meets the resident goals and needs and provides quality are by conducting pulmonary function tests; assessing and interpreting evaluations and test results; determining respiratory therapy treatment plans in consultation with physicians and by prescription. Helps resident accomplish treatment plan and supports life by administering inhalants, operating mechanical ventilators, therapeutic gas administration apparatus, environmental control systems, and aerosol generators. Administers respiratory therapy treatments by performing bronchopulmonary drainage; assisting with breathing exercises; monitoring physiological responses to therapy, such as vital signs, arterial blood gasses, and blood chemistry changes; directing treatments given by nursing department. Evaluates effects of respiratory therapy treatment plan by observing, noting, and evaluating patient’s progress, recommending adjustments and modifications. Completes discharge planning by consulting with physicians, nurses, social workers, and other health care workers, contributing to patient care conferences. Assures continuation of therapeutic plan following discharge by designing home exercise programs; instructing patients, families, and caregivers in home exercise programs; recommending and/or providing assistive equipment; recommending outpatient or home health follow-up programs.
